AI Cloud Services in the UK: Looking Ahead to 2025
The UK’s AI cloud sector is developing at a remarkable pace, set to redefine business operations by 2025. Already, industries like manufacturing, finance, and healthcare are benefiting from scalable, intelligent systems that streamline operations and unlock insights. Between 2023 and 2024, the number of AI-focused companies surged by 58%, reflecting the UK’s dynamic and innovation-driven market. Clear regulatory frameworks introduced by the government are also fostering trust and providing an environment where AI applications can safely thrive across industries.

Cost-Efficiency and Scalability of AI Tools
For small and medium-sized businesses, AI delivered via the cloud provides an affordable entry point into advanced technologies. Automating repetitive tasks lowers labor costs, while subscription-based models eliminate the need for heavy upfront investment. UK government programs are reducing barriers to adoption by offering grants, guidance, and expertise, making it easier for SMEs to innovate and compete with larger firms.
Collaboration and Training: Keys to Successful AI Adoption
Strategic collaborations are playing an essential role in AI integration. Partnerships such as NatWest’s collaboration with Google Cloud provide both tools and training, enabling entrepreneurs to maximize their AI capabilities. Support schemes like the NatWest Accelerator have shown tangible impact, with participating firms seeing average investment growth of 70.5% over three years. These initiatives highlight the importance of structured training and ecosystem support for successful AI adoption.
